Frequently Asked Questions Why Live in Syracuse

Is Syracuse a good place to live?
Syracuse is a good place to live. Syracuse is considered car-dependent and somewhat bikeable. Syracuse has 3 parks for recreational activities. It has a median age of 42. The average household income is $83,117 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 25.6% of residents. A majority of residents in Syracuse are home owners, with 26% of residents renting and 74%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Syracuse?
The median home price in Syracuse is $320,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$64,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.67%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$1,650 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$71K a year to afford the median home price in Syracuse.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in Syracuse is $83K.
